There’s no end to the wacky designs that are being displayed at SEMA this year, and the Alé high-mileage car from Fuel Vapor Technologies (FVT) is probably the strangest one this side of Jay Leno’s EcoJet. Created by inventor George Parker, the Alé concept has been in development for almost 15 years and is the first entry that we’ve seen for the Automotive X-Prize competition. Honda’s 500HP Element-D drift carHonda has created the Element-D drift car, which it has unveiled at the SEMA auto show. Based on the regular Honda crossover, the Element-D racer replaces the stock four-cylinder engine with a custom twin-turbo 3.2-liter Honda V6 mounted longitudinally and driving the rear wheels only. Ford has gone big at SEMA this year, displaying no less than three hotted up Mustangs GT500s in drag, street-racer and full race specs. The most extroverted was easily the Shelby GT500 Professional Road Racer, complete with Ford Racing's 5.0L Cammer engine. Power is said to be significantly higher than the stock 500hp version and looking at the huge 6-piston calipers upfront, biting 2-piece rotors, we’d have to agree.
